Synchro technology definition

Synchro technology refers to a device that is commonly used to transmit the indications of angular movement or position to another location. The synchro device is an electromechanical device that is widely used in automation industries, especially in the aviation and military sectors. Its key aim is to transmit accurate information about the position or movement of different parts, such as control surfaces of an airplane, from one location to another.

This technology has many different applications, including remotely controlling robotic devices, aircraft weapons systems, or even communication systems. The synchro device is straightforward in design, consisting of a rotor and a stator. The rotor is often connected to a shaft that is rotating in response to some motion or position change. In contrast, the stator is fixed in place and has a pickup attached to it.

As the rotor moves, the pickup picks up the signals and sends them to the stator, which then sends a signal to the synchro receiver. The signal sent through the receiver is usually in the form of an AC voltage. The receiver then converts the signal to the desired information on position or angle of movement.

In summary, synchro technology is a crucial component in many industries, helping to transmit accurate information about angular motion and position changes. Its simplicity and adaptability make it an essential piece of technology in the world of automation.
